President Joe Biden is expected to announce Thursday that all federal employees and contractors must be vaccinated against COVID-19 or get tested regularly, CNN reported late Tuesday, citing a knowledgeable source.
The President is expected to stop short of imposing the mandate on service members, the report said. He may outline steps that DOD will take in the future.
Biden confirmed to reporters Tuesday that the move is “under consideration,” and he blamed unvaccinated Americans for a rise in new cases and the need for more mitigation steps.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ention has recommended that even vaccinated people should wear masks indoors in COVID-19 hot spots.
“The more we learn about this virus and the Delta variant, the more we have to be worried and concerned,” Biden said. “And there’s only one thing we know for sure: If those other hundred million people got vaccinated, we’d be in a very different world,” he said.
